10 things I have learned from 10 years as an author (Part 3)

8. Don’t compare yourself to others
9. Art is subjective, if someone doesn’t like your work it has nothing to do with you and everything to do with them
10. Never let anyone tell you your story isn’t good. Every story deserves to be told

* 10 things I have learned from 10 years as an author (Part 2)

5. It will take time. Weeks, months, years. It doesn’t matter.

6. It’s okay to rewrite entire scenes, chapters, or the whole book until the story feels right

7. The process for drafting each book might be different, and that’s okay

* 10 things I have learned from 10 years as an author (Part 1)

1. The first draft doesn’t have to be good, it just has to be written

2. You don’t have to feel inspiration all the time

3. But if you feel it, write it

4. Write the stories for yourself, not the audience
